Usha Thorat takes over as RBI Deputy Governor
MUMBAI: Usha Thorat has taken over as Deputy Governor of the Reserve Bank of India (RBI). Her appointment is for five years. Ms. Thorat held the post of Executive Director of the RBI since April 2004. ...

Sensex ends flat
MUMBAI: The Bombay Stock Exchange on Thursday ended flat in volatile trading. The BSE Sensex opened higher at 8314.39 and later fluctuated in a limited range of 8342.53 and 8265.26 before ending the day at 8308.93 against yesterday's close of ...
